Perovskite Solar Cells: Setting New Efficiency Records

Perovskite solar cells have emerged as frontrunners in the quest for higher efficiency and lower costs. These cells utilize perovskite materials to capture sunlight and convert it into electricity. Recent breakthroughs have pushed perovskite solar cell efficiencies beyond 25%, rivaling those of traditional silicon-based cells. The versatility and scalability of perovskite materials make them a game-changer in the solar industry. With ongoing research focused on enhancing stability and durability, perovskite solar cells are poised to redefine the efficiency standards of solar power generation.

Tandem Solar Cells: Maximizing Energy Harvesting Potential

Tandem solar cells represent another significant advancement in energy conversion efficiency, leveraging multiple layers of photovoltaic materials to capture a broader spectrum of sunlight. Recent developments have propelled tandem solar cell efficiencies to unprecedented levels exceeding 29%, surpassing the performance of single-junction cells. By optimizing material combinations and fabrication techniques, tandem solar cells offer the promise of even higher efficiencies in the near future. As manufacturing processes become more streamlined and costs continue to decline, tandem solar cells are expected to play a pivotal role in driving the widespread adoption of solar energy.

Bifacial Solar Panels: Harnessing Sunlight from All Angles

Bifacial solar panels are revolutionizing solar energy production by capturing sunlight from both the front and rear surfaces. These panels can utilize reflected sunlight from surrounding surfaces, such as rooftops or the ground, to generate additional electricity. Studies have demonstrated that bifacial solar panels can increase energy output by up to 20%, making them an attractive option for maximizing solar energy generation in diverse environments. As installation techniques evolve and manufacturing efficiencies improve, bifacial solar panels are rapidly gaining traction as a viable solution for optimizing solar energy systems.

Smart Solar Technologies: Enhancing Efficiency and Monitoring

The integration of smart technologies into solar panels is reshaping the way we harness and manage solar energy. Smart solar panels incorporate sensors, microcontrollers, and communication capabilities to optimize system performance and provide real-time monitoring data. These advancements enable precise tracking of energy production, early detection of issues, and remote system management, ultimately empowering greater efficiency and reliability. With further advancements in artificial intelligence and data analytics, smart solar technologies are poised to revolutionize the solar industry by maximizing energy output and minimizing operational costs.
